So, what defines a top-rated electric massager? Often, it boils down to effectiveness and user experience. Let’s talk numbers: While many electric massagers operate on frequencies between 30-60Hz for vibration, top-tier models might offer additional features like heat functions to enhance muscle relaxation. Some brands even throw in warranties to ensure longevity, often up to two years. Prices can vary significantly based on these additional features, with budget-friendly options starting as low as $50, and more deluxe versions reaching upwards of $200. But remember, while cost often correlates with quality, finding a balance between budget and the necessary features is key.

Let’s not forget about some of the household names in the industry. Companies like TheraGun and Hyperice have garnered attention with their high-quality products. TheraGun, for instance, offers percussive therapy, which has been backed by numerous professional athletes and trainers. Their attention to detail and focus on providing efficient relief have cemented their status in the market. Hyperice focuses on integrating technology with therapeutic benefits, often praised for their sleek designs and easy-to-use interfaces. It’s no wonder they have a loyal following.
Ergonomic design plays a crucial role too because comfort isn’t just about how the device feels on your muscles, but how it feels in your hand. You want a massager that fits comfortably, minimizes strain during use, and reaches those tricky spots without contortionist-level maneuvers.
Finally, are these electrical companions truly suitable for daily use? According to numerous experts and my own personal experiences, the answer is a resounding yes. Most companies even recommend daily usage to maximize benefits. However, as with anything, moderation holds the key. The body needs time to heal and recuperate, and overuse may cause more harm than good. The takeaway here is simple: follow the recommended guidelines, listen to your body, and maybe consult your physician if in doubt.
